Analysis

The most recent figure for value added deflator (manufacturing) β€” value us$, 2015 prices in British Virgin Islands is 132.61 USD,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 54 years on record.

The figure is up 6.5% on the previous year and up 42.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, value added deflator (manufacturing) β€” value us$, 2015 prices in British Virgin Islands peaked at 132.61 USD in 2023 and was at its lowest, 24 USD, in 1971.

That places British Virgin Islands 41st out of 200 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 54 years of available data.

The FAOSTAT Deflators database provides the following selection of price deflator series by country and at regional level: Gross Domestic Product deflator, Gross Fixed Capital Formation deflator, Manufacturing Value-Added deflator, and Agriculture, Forestry, Fishery Valued-Added deflator. In the FAOSTAT Deflators database, all series are derived from the United Nations Statistics Division (UNSD) National Accounts Analysis of Main Aggregates database (UNSD AMA). In particular, the implicit Gross Domestic Product deflator, the implicit Gross Fixed Capital Formation deflator, the implicit value added deflator of Agriculture, Forestry, Fishery and the implicit value added deflator of Manufacturing are obtained by dividing the series in current prices by those in constant 2015 prices (base year).
